Definition and Scope:
The Medical Smoke Evacuation System is a crucial piece of equipment used in healthcare facilities to remove smoke, aerosols, and other potentially harmful byproducts generated during surgical procedures. This system consists of a vacuum pump, tubing, filters, and a smoke evacuation pencil or nozzle. The primary function of the Medical Smoke Evacuation System is to maintain a safe and clean environment in operating rooms by effectively capturing and filtering out surgical smoke, which may contain harmful substances such as viruses, bacteria, and carcinogens. By eliminating these airborne contaminants, the system helps protect the health and safety of both healthcare workers and patients.
In recent years, there has been a growing awareness of the health risks associated with surgical smoke exposure, driving the demand for Medical Smoke Evacuation Systems in healthcare settings. Healthcare facilities are increasingly adopting stringent safety protocols and guidelines to mitigate the risks posed by surgical smoke, thereby fueling the market growth for smoke evacuation systems. Additionally, advancements in technology have led to the development of more efficient and user-friendly smoke evacuation systems, further contributing to the market expansion. The increasing focus on occupational safety and regulatory compliance in the healthcare sector is also a key factor driving the adoption of Medical Smoke Evacuation Systems.
Moreover, the market for Medical Smoke Evacuation Systems is witnessing a surge in demand due to the ongoing COVID-19 pandemic, which has highlighted the importance of maintaining a clean and safe surgical environment. Healthcare facilities are now placing greater emphasis on infection control measures, including the use of smoke evacuation systems, to minimize the spread of airborne pathogens. This trend is expected to continue in the foreseeable future, driving the market growth for Medical Smoke Evacuation Systems. Additionally, the rising number of surgical procedures being performed globally, coupled with increasing investments in healthcare infrastructure, is anticipated to further propel the market expansion for these systems.
The global Medical Smoke Evacuation System market size was estimated at USD 633.15 million in 2024, exhibiting a CAGR of 5.00% during the forecast period.
